Output 143dd7bc8a7d1af57960b61da3535c1aa383f1ca14c7ba11260a9a187d5f53e5:0

value
2366709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36c182e8772e283f87358a7ccac6350ed47e156e OP_EQUAL
address
MCtgYCCup3V7tofB9LSEZrxbGMmxBiBuHu
transaction
143dd7bc8a7d1af57960b61da3535c1aa383f1ca14c7ba11260a9a187d5f53e5
spent
true